Transaction 22f82aa8eeecbc51731d0d91ca2644b2e45df3353e1e72dc7e02223f47497636

87 Input
2 Outputs
  • 22f82aa8eeecbc51731d0d91ca2644b2e45df3353e1e72dc7e02223f47497636:0
  • value  3000000000
    address  1d5bogJvWy6HeZ3v5ZnBLyiATM2vPsKrk
  • 22f82aa8eeecbc51731d0d91ca2644b2e45df3353e1e72dc7e02223f47497636:1
  • value  3457823
    address  12Xmv6cm73dr4P2DFVuTRbELkAVMPuykye